DENTIST SHOT AT.
ATTACKED BY A JEALOUS WOMAN By Telegra.ph—Press Association. Auckland, Thursday. Kathleen Sommerville, a mechanical dentist, went into the rooms of J. IT. Cohvill, dentist, this afternoon, locked the door of his office, and said she would shoot him unless he agreed to renew their friendship and assist her in her work. Cohvill declined, and threatening to call the police, went to the door with the intention of doing so, when it is stated Miss Sommerville fired a revolver, the bullet entering the wall within two inches of Cohvill's head as he went through the door. The woman has heon arrested. During the afternoon Kathleen Sommerville was charged with attempting to murder W. J. Cohvill. A remand was granted till to-morrow.
